Touring cycling routes around Aintree Village primarily traverse flat terrain, characterized by converted railway lines and historic canal towpaths. The area features extensive traffic-free green corridors, offering accessible paths through urban green spaces. These routes connect to wider regional landscapes, including the Leeds & Liverpool Canal and areas surrounding the iconic Aintree Racecourse. The topography is generally low-lying, providing a network suitable for various cycling abilities.

October 6, 2025, Liverpool Loop Line

A converted rail line, perfect for cycling, running etc. Path runs from Halewood Park triangle in the South East to Fazakerley/Orrell Park in North West, is tarmacked whole way through and lined by vegetation and remnants of rail infrastructure. No street lights along the path so carry a good set of lights if traveling at later hours.

Frequently Asked Questions

How many touring cycling routes are available around Aintree Village?

There are over 220 touring cycling routes around Aintree Village, catering to various skill levels. More than half of these, around 116, are classified as easy, making the area very accessible for different cyclists.

What is the general terrain like for touring cycling in Aintree Village?

The touring cycling routes around Aintree Village are predominantly flat, utilizing converted railway lines and historic canal towpaths. You'll find extensive traffic-free green corridors, providing accessible paths through urban green spaces and connecting to wider regional landscapes like the Leeds & Liverpool Canal.

What do other cyclists think about the touring routes in Aintree Village?

The touring cycling routes in Aintree Village are highly regarded by the komoot community, with an average rating of 4.5 out of 5 stars from over 330 reviews. Cyclists often praise the well-maintained, traffic-free paths and the scenic variety offered by the canal towpaths and green corridors.

Are there any traffic-free cycling routes in Aintree Village suitable for families?

Yes, Aintree Village is excellent for traffic-free cycling, particularly along the Liverpool Loop Line and sections of the Leeds & Liverpool Canal. These routes offer flat, well-surfaced paths ideal for families and less experienced cyclists seeking a tranquil ride through green spaces.

Can I find circular touring cycling routes in the area?

Yes, many touring cycling routes around Aintree Village are designed as loops. For example, the Leeds & Liverpool Canal – Aintree Racecourse loop from Aintree offers a moderate 16.6-mile circular journey, combining historic canal paths with views of the iconic racecourse.

What kind of landmarks or attractions can I see while cycling around Aintree Village?

While cycling, you can pass by the famous Aintree Racecourse. The area's proximity to Liverpool also means you can easily access city attractions. For instance, you might encounter the Royal Liver Building or The Beatles Statue if your route extends towards the city center. The Royal Albert Dock Liverpool is another notable historical site nearby.

Are there any routes that follow canals?

Absolutely. The Leeds & Liverpool Canal is a significant feature for touring cyclists in the area. Routes like the Leeds & Liverpool Canal – Canal Pathway Near Fields loop from Fazakerley offer pleasant rides along its historic towpaths, providing opportunities for nature spotting and a peaceful cycling experience.

Are there any longer touring cycling routes for more experienced riders?

Yes, for those seeking a longer ride, the Liverpool Loop Line – Halewood Duck Pond loop from Orrell Park is a moderate 26.7-mile path. This route allows you to explore a more extensive section of the Liverpool Loop Line, offering a journey through varied green corridors and a greater distance.

What are some natural features or green spaces accessible by bike?

Aintree Village is characterized by its urban green corridors and proximity to natural features. The Liverpool Loop Line itself is a green corridor, and you can also explore areas like Lunt Meadows Nature Reserve or Greenbank Park, which are accessible from various routes.

Are there routes that pass by the Aintree Racecourse?

Yes, you can find routes that take you past the iconic Aintree Racecourse. The The Grand National – Lady Green Garden Centre loop from Aintree is an easy 32.9-mile route that offers views of the racecourse and extends into the surrounding areas.

What is the best time of year for touring cycling in Aintree Village?

Given the flat terrain and network of paths, touring cycling in Aintree Village is enjoyable for much of the year. Spring and summer offer pleasant weather for exploring the green corridors and canal paths. Autumn can also be beautiful with changing foliage, while winter rides are possible on the well-surfaced, traffic-free routes, though conditions may vary.

Are there any coastal cycling options near Aintree Village?

While Aintree Village itself is inland, its proximity to the coast means you can extend your rides to coastal areas. Destinations like New Brighton Beach and the Wirral Country Park offer a change of scenery with coastal paths and views, providing diverse cycling experiences within reach.
